AN EXTREMELY RARE PINFIRE SELF-ACTING MILLICHAMPS PATENT FIELD CLOCK GUN,
circa 1890, incorporates a large revolver which holds up to eight 16-gauge pinfire cartridges linked to a clockwork mechanism which can be set to fire a cartridge at set intervals from every 15 minutes up to every 1.5 hours, the mechanisms are attached to a wooden base with cast-iron feet, which is covered by a hinged galvanised tin lid with a looped carrying handle which allowed it to be hung in a tree, on one side is the exit hole for the shot, and on the other is a stylised sketch of a woodpigeon which was applied by the manufacturer; an oval brass plate with raised script 'MILLICHAMPS / PATENT / FIELD CLOCK GUN/ PRESTEIGNE RADNORSHIRE' is attached to the base between the revolver and the clock, 14 1/2 in. x 15 1/2 in. x 12 in., appears complete but untested
